Нет ничего более важного для разработчика, чем умение создавать интуитивно понятные и эффективные пользовательские интерфейсы. Один из главных элементов, способствующих этому, - линейка делений. Это горизонтальная или вертикальная шкала, показывающая отметки на оси, с которыми пользователи могут взаимодействовать для выбора определенных значений. В этой статье мы расскажем вам о том, как построить линейку делений методом х2 у2 в Dash - одном из самых популярных фреймворков для создания интерактивных веб-приложений.
Метод х2 у2 представляет собой определенную формулу, используемую для расчета интервалов между делениями на линейке. Формула основана на последовательности чисел, где каждое последующее число является удвоенным предыдущим, увеличенным на два. Этот метод обеспечивает равномерные интервалы между делениями, что делает пользовательский опыт более понятным и интуитивным.
Ваша работа как разработчика - реализовать метод х2 у2 в Dash. Для этого вам потребуется использовать библиотеку Dash, создать интерфейс с помощью HTML и CSS, а затем написать код на языке Python. Вам потребуется определить начальные и конечные значения, создать формулу для расчета интервалов и создать визуальное представление линейки делений. Вся эта работа будет основана на концепции компонентов, предоставляемых Dash, которые позволяют вам создавать интерактивные элементы пользовательского интерфейса.
Приветственные слова, Ассистент!
Хочу пожелать вам удачи в освоении этого мощного инструмента и надеюсь, что наш полный гайд поможет вам создавать потрясающие линейки делений ваших пользовательских интерфейсов!
Что такое линейка делений методом х2 у2 в Dash?
Этот метод позволяет создавать линейки с делениями, которые автоматически увеличиваются или уменьшаются в 2 раза на каждом шагу. Вместо того, чтобы постоянно задавать количество и интервалы делений вручную, можно использовать метод х2 у2 и получить более гибкую, автоматическую настройку осей.
При использовании линейки делений методом х2 у2, график будет содержать деления, которые могут быть равномерно распределены на оси в зависимости от выбранного диапазона значений. Это делает визуализацию данных более удобной и позволяет легко настраивать оси под нужные требования.
Описание и принцип работы
В данной статье мы рассмотрим метод построения линейки делений методом х2 у2 в Dash. Этот метод основан на принципе создания двух копий основной линейки, каждая из которых будет уменьшаться вдвое по ширине и увеличиваться вдвое по длине.
Для начала создадим таблицу, в которой будут отображаться наши деления. В таблице будет одна строка и четыре ячейки, каждая из которых будет содержать по одной линейке. Для удобства, можно добавить заголовок для каждой линейки, чтобы было понятно, что они отображают.
Основная линейка | Линейка х2 | Линейка у2 | Линейка х2 у2 |
---|---|---|---|
Теперь перейдем к самому методу построения линеек. Для начала, создадим основную линейку, которая будет располагаться в первой ячейке таблицы. Это может быть просто горизонтальная линия, которая будет представлять собой ось.
Далее, создадим линейку х2, которая будет располагаться во второй ячейке таблицы. У этой линейки будет вдвое меньшая ширина и вдвое большая длина по сравнению с основной линейкой. Для создания линейки х2 можно воспользоваться CSS свойствами transform: scaleX(0.5);
и transform: scaleY(2);
.
Аналогичным образом создаем линейку у2 в третьей ячейке таблицы. Ее ширина будет также вдвое меньше, а длина вдвое больше по сравнению с основной линейкой.
Наконец, создаем линейку х2 у2 в четвертой ячейке таблицы. У нее и ширина будет вдвое меньше, и длина вдвое больше по сравнению с основной линейкой. Для этого комбинируем свойства для линеек х2 и у2: transform: scaleX(0.5) scaleY(2);
.
Таким образом, мы получаем четыре линейки с разными масштабами, которые представляют собой деления нашей основной линейки. Этот метод позволяет более наглядно отображать различные значения на графике или диаграмме, а также облегчает восприятие данных пользователем.
Инструменты и требования для построения линейки делений методом х2 у2 в Dash
Для построения линейки делений методом х2 у2 в Dash вам потребуются следующие инструменты и выполнение определенных требований:
1. Python и Dash: Убедитесь, что у вас установлен Python и библиотека Dash. Python - это язык программирования, который используется для создания веб-приложений, а Dash - это библиотека Python, которая предоставляет средства для создания интерактивных веб-приложений.
2. Редактор кода: Вы можете использовать любой удобный вам редактор кода, такой как Visual Studio Code, Sublime Text, PyCharm и т.д. Эти редакторы обеспечивают удобную среду для написания кода и предлагают множество полезных функций, таких как подсветка синтаксиса, автозаполнение и отладка кода.
3. Знание HTML и CSS: Чтобы настроить внешний вид вашей линейки делений, вам потребуется знание HTML и CSS. HTML (язык разметки гипертекста) используется для создания структуры веб-страницы, а CSS (каскадные таблицы стилей) позволяют задать внешний вид элементов страницы, таких как цвет, размер и расположение.
4. Базовые знания Python и Dash: Необходимо иметь базовые знания Python и Dash для понимания основных концепций и функций, необходимых для построения линейки делений методом х2 у2 в Dash.
5. Установка необходимых библиотек: Убедитесь, что у вас установлены все необходимые библиотеки для работы с Dash. В зависимости от конкретного приложения вам может потребоваться установить дополнительные библиотеки для обработки данных, создания графиков или других функций.
Следуя этим требованиям и используя необходимые инструменты, вы будете готовы построить линейку делений методом х2 у2 в Dash и создать интерактивное веб-приложение, которое поможет вам в работе с данными.
Необходимое программное обеспечение и библиотеки
Для построения линейки делений методом х2 у2 в Dash вам понадобится следующее программное обеспечение и библиотеки:
- Python: Dash является фреймворком Python, поэтому вам нужно иметь установленную версию Python.
- Dash: Dash - это фреймворк для создания интерактивных веб-приложений на Python. Вы можете установить его с помощью pip:
- Plotly: Plotly - это библиотека визуализации данных, которая включает в себя множество инструментов для создания различных графиков и диаграмм. Dash использует Plotly для построения графиков, поэтому вам потребуется установить его:
pip install dash
pip install plotly
После установки всех необходимых компонентов вы будете готовы начать создание линейки делений методом х2 у2 в вашем Dash-приложении!
Шаги по созданию линейки делений методом х2 у2 в Dash
Для создания линейки делений методом х2 у2 в Dash, следуйте приведенным ниже шагам:
- Импортируйте необходимые библиотеки для работы с Dash.
- Создайте объект класса `Dash` и определите его визуальный интерфейс.
- Определите функции, которые будут отвечать за обновление графиков и отображение данных.
- Создайте интерактивные элементы для ввода параметров.
- Определите обработчики событий для элементов управления.
- Определите функцию, которая будет вызываться при изменении входных параметров и обновлять графики.
- Создайте таблицу для отображения результатов.
- Определите функцию, которая будет отвечать за обновление таблицы.
- Создайте макет интерфейса, разместите на нем элементы управления и графики.
- Запустите Dash-приложение.
После выполнения всех шагов вы получите интерактивную линейку делений методом х2 у2 в Dash.